Family Medicine at The Allen Hospital
The Family Medicine Department at The Allen Hospital provides comprehensive, primary medical care to adults and children in the Washington Heights and Inwood area. The Department is devoted to increasing access to primary care in our community and has adopted a far broader approach to care than is ordinarily found in primary care practices. This approach, called Community Oriented Primary Care, involves the assessment of community problems and development of appropriate interventions in conjunction with community members.
These include outreach and educational programs such as:
- Breastfeeding education programs
- Literacy program for children under age 5
- Smoking prevention programs in grade schools
- HIV education program for minority girls
- Peer mentoring program
The Department's primary care practice includes about a staff of about 35 and is comprised of physicians, psychologists, psychiatrists, a nutritionist, social worker, and OB/GYN specialists. Together, we care for more than 25,000 patients each year with conditions such as high blood pressure, asthma, diabetes, and pregnancy.

The Farrell Center provides primary and ambulatory care. The Allen Practice provides inpatient and specialty care. Pediatric patients who require hospital admission are generally transferred to the Morgan Stanley Children's Hospital of New York-Presbyterian Hospital.
